Belgium set up final with Argentina


Photo: Getty ImagesBelgium set up an intriguing men's Olympic hockey final against Argentina after they dumped out the world's second-ranked team the Netherlands with a resounding 3-1 semifinal victory. Goals from Jerome Truyens, Florent van Aubel and John-John Dohmen guaranteed Belgium a place in their first ever Olympic final. "They played really well and I think we just sort of gave it away in the first half," Van der Weerden said. Belgium were on the back foot for most of the third quarter as they attempted to stifle the impressive Dutch attack, led by Van der Weerden. They will face an in-form Argentina side, who powered into the final with a stunning 5-2 upset of defending champions Germany.
